At 408 US rig count approaches record low
Kristen Nelson Petroleum News
At a count of 408 for the week ending May 1, the U.S. drilling rig count is approaching the low of 404 it hit in May 2016.
Baker Hughes reported the 408 count for U.S. oil and gas drilling rigs, down from 465 from the week ending April 24 and down 582 from a year ago.
